St. Louis Cardinals vs. San Francisco Giants Prediction
For tonight's ESPN game, the Cardinals will pitch Adam Wainwright, a veteran right-hander. Wainwright has a 3.18 ERA but is 3-4 on the season.
However, Wainwright hasn't nearly been as good as his ERA suggests, with a 4.74 xFIP in the last 30 days. In that same time frame, he's got just 15.6% of strikeouts and has walked 11.5% of batters. He's still limited the power well enough.
Wainwright will take on a Giants lineup that has a .153 ISO and wOBA of .334 against righties in the last 30 days. San Francisco only strikes out 17.4% of the time and walks 9.6% of the time in those 30 days against righties.

The main contributors when it comes to power would be two lefties in LaMonte Wade and Joc Pederson. But Wade's numbers are off just 13 plate appearances as he missed the beginning of the year.
For the Giants, it'll be left-handed ace Carlos Rodon. He’s 4-1 with a 1.80 ERA. He's also been worse than his ERA but still has put together a 3.29 xFIP along with 35.7% of strikeouts. Rodon has walked 8.7% of batters in the last 30 days, however, and isn't earning many ground balls. But takes those numbers with a grain of salt. It doesn't matter if he's striking out a whole bunch of hitters.

Rodon will have to go up against a tough Cardinals lineup, however. The Cardinals have been terrific against lefties this year as the projected lineup for the Cardinals has a .158 ISO but a wOBA of .340 against lefties in the last 30 days.
The Cardinals also strike out just 15.4% of the time in that same time frame with 10.6% of walks against lefties. If they're able to limit strikeouts and put the ball in play, the Cardinals will tack on some runs along with the Giants. Let's take the Over 7.
